Los Amigos is a sub-regional blend from the Department of Huila in Colombia. This blend is composed of microlots from four small producers from the micro-regions of San Agustín and Bruselas. The concept of a sub-regional blend comes from the desire to support smallholder farmers by combining very small lots to produce a larger coffee with better marketability. Truly, these lots together are greater than the sum of their parts. The four producers who have contributed lots to this coffee are:

Edilma Quinayas - San Agustín
Miller Quinayas - San Agustín
Luis Octavio Titimbo - Bruselas
Ana Nelly Luna - Bruselas

Decaf Amigos is decaffeinated using the Ethyl Acetate process. This process utilizes sugarcane, which is often grown at lower elevations than coffee and frequently planted at the bottom of the same mountains where coffee is grown. The Ethyl Acetate process gently extracts the caffeine from coffee beans as the solvent is washed over the beans repeatedly until more than 97% of the caffeine has been removed.
